I agree the size is a huge bonus, but for people who shoot in competition like I do, it’s very important the accuracy. The FX Chrono, I don’t even use any longer after seeing how inaccurate it actually is. I would recommend either the pro Krono or the caldwell chronograph as the ones with two sensors that measure the speed between them are much more reliable than any radar chronograph, obviously, the Garman is just as good you can see by my example, but as for radar chronographs, I think Garmin is the best way to go, because I need to know my exact velocity to calculate my exact energy, all of those numbers are critical in competitions, as there are sometimes energy limitations, or energy, maximum minimums, very specific coordinates for your velocity and energy to meet in order to be compliant that event. I know for most people shooting in their backyard. It doesn’t matter, but for me, and others like me it definitely does matter. That’s my third set of lights, the rods are totally bent, that’s why I keep having to adjust them, that’s been shot with my rattler, which really bent the shit out of it, the Pantera bent it it’s been bent several times. Honestly I really do like the Garman better than either one. The FX is obviously shit, I didn’t think so until now, because I honestly never tested it against anything else. I never thought I should, or had to, obviously I was wrong. I got it for free with my first impact, so it’s not the end of the world but now I know why. So I don’t really have a way to determine which is the most accurate but the Garman is damn sure the most convenient and it’s pretty goddamn accurate. It was within one or 2 ft./s of the pro Chrono every time they both registered, and the only time the Garmin didn’t register Was when I fired rapidly which no one really does when you’re testing velocity, I just did because I was really putting it to the test. So my vote is the Garmin 110%.
